EDMOND, Okla. - Northwest Missouri State University junior
Franco Oliva took second-place honors in singles at the 2021 ITA Central Region Championships on Sunday.
Oliva, who won the 2018 ITA Central Region singles title, came up one victory short of claiming his second region championship. Oliva picked up a 6-3, 7-5 win over Ouachita Baptist's Francisco Oliveira in the semifinal to begin his Sunday action.
In the final, Oliva matched up with Marko Nikoliuk (Southern Arkansas). Nikoliuk reached the final by knocking off Oliva's teammate No. 1 seed
Andrea Zamurri in the other semifinal - 2-6, 6-3, 6-2. Nikoliuk captured the crown with a 6-3, 7-5 triumph over Oliva.
On the women's side, Northwest's
Angela per Moreno was topped by Missouri Western's Claudia Iglesias Iglesias in the Open B semifinal.
